Open Enrollment
-
If you are not a resident within the Columbia Heights Public School district you may still be able to have your student(s) register in one of our schools. Minnesota Statute 124D.03 allows all Minnesota's public school students the opportunity to apply to attend a school outside of the student's home district by open enrolling. Families are encouraged to apply before January 15 of each year to have the best chance of being admitted to one of our schools.
Download the free PreK Open Enrollment Form (Spanish)
Download the K-12 and Early Childhood Special Education Open Enrollment Form (Spanish)
There is no charge for open enrollment; however, the student and his/her family is responsible for providing their own transportation. Transportation options are sometimes available by contacting the schools transportation department. Please know that Open Enrollment applicants are accepted depending on space availability.
